Abstract: Disclosed herein system, apparatus, article of manufacture, method and/or computer program product embodiments, and/or combinations and sub-combinations thereof, for using technology in innovative ways to automatically and intelligently predict performance of content delivery networks (CDNs) in a crowdsourced manner in order to deliver the highest resolution content possible with little or no buffering. In some embodiments, a media device downloads and displays primary content on a display device. The media device determines that secondary content should be stitched into the display of the primary content. Accordingly, the media device requests that a crowdsource server determine a bit-rate variant of the secondary content to download. The crowdsource server determines the bit-rate variant in a crowdsourced manner such that subsequent download of the identified bit-rate variant by the media device results in a zero buffer experience. The media device downloads the determined bit-rate variant of the secondary content, and stitches the downloaded bit-rate variant of the secondary content into the display of the primary content.

Abstract: Disclosed herein are system, method, and computer program product embodiments for network-based user identification. An embodiment operates by determining a media access control (MAC) address of each of a plurality of mobile devices that have previously interacted with a streaming media device. A discovery signal is transmit to the MAC addresses of the plurality of mobile devices. Responses indicating a network address of each of the respective responding mobile devices are received. One or more user settings of the streaming media device are determined based on identified user settings corresponding to the plurality of responding mobile devices. The streaming media device is configured based on the identified one more user settings.

Abstract: Disclosed herein are system, apparatus, article of manufacture, method and/or computer program product embodiments, and/or combinations and sub-combinations thereof, for automatically determining the functionality and capabilities of electronic components. Some embodiments operate by transmitting a command to the display device in question (sometimes called the device under test—DUT—herein) and monitoring the device. Then, it is determined whether an action by the display device was one of a set of proper responses to the command. If the action was proper, then it is determined that the display device supports the command set associated with the command. The command set may be the Consumer Electronics Control (CEC) set, although this disclosure is not limited to that example.

Abstract: Various embodiments for customizing a user interface based on user capabilities are described herein. An embodiment operates by detecting an interaction performed by a user with a user interface of a mobile device, the interaction being detected on a detection date and time. A biometric of the user is determined based on the interaction with the user interface of the mobile device. An initial identity of the user based is generated on the determined biometric of the user. A usage history for the initial identity of the user is retrieved. The detection date and time is compared to the usage history. The initial identity of the user is verified as an actual identity of the user based on the comparing. The user interface is customized based on the capabilities of the user in interacting with the user interface corresponding to the determined biometric after the verifying.

Abstract: Provided herein are various embodiments for synchronizing playback of audio and video. An embodiment operates by determining that a first quality video is being received at a media device. It is determined that a buffer of the media device is not large enough to buffer the first quality video long enough to synchronize an output of the high quality video with the output of the audio by one or more wireless speakers. A second quality of the video that the buffer can hold long enough to synchronize is identified, wherein the second quality of the video is lower than the first quality of the video. The media device outputs the video at the second quality and the corresponding audio to the one or more wireless speakers.
